South Korea and NVIDIA Collaborate to Enhance AI Infrastructure with Over 250,000 GPUs

NVIDIA partners with South Korea to deploy over a quarter-million GPUs, boosting AI infrastructure to drive innovation in industries like automotive and manufacturing.

South Korea is set to become a global powerhouse in artificial intelligence (AI) as it partners with NVIDIA, according to a recent announcement from NVIDIA Newsroom. The collaboration aims to expand the nation’s AI infrastructure by deploying over a quarter-million NVIDIA GPUs across sovereign clouds and AI factories in South Korea. This initiative is expected to significantly enhance the country’s capabilities in various sectors, including automotive, manufacturing, and telecommunications.

Major Investments in AI Infrastructure

The Korean government, through the Ministry of Science and ICT, plans to invest heavily in sovereign AI infrastructure. This includes deploying over 50,000 of the latest NVIDIA GPUs across the National AI Computing Center and cloud service providers such as NHN Cloud, Kakao Corp., and NAVER Cloud. Samsung Electronics will also construct an AI factory with a similar number of GPUs to accelerate its AI and semiconductor development.

SK Group is designing an AI factory that will host over 50,000 NVIDIA GPUs, featuring Asia’s first industrial AI cloud for physical AI and robotics. Meanwhile, Hyundai Motor Group will collaborate with NVIDIA to build an AI factory with 50,000 NVIDIA Blackwell GPUs, focusing on manufacturing and autonomous driving.

Public-Private Partnerships for LLM Development

NAVER Cloud, LG AI Research, SK Telecom, NC AI, Upstage, and NVIDIA are working together to develop Korean foundation large language models (LLMs) through public-private partnerships. This collaboration aims to enhance AI applications across the nation, promoting innovation and growth.

The Korea Institute of Science and Technology Information (KISTI) is also establishing a Center of Excellence for quantum computing and scientific research, utilizing NVIDIA’s accelerated computing technology.

Supporting Startups and Economic Growth

To further support economic development, NVIDIA and its partners are forming an alliance to foster startups through the NVIDIA Inception program. This initiative will provide startups with access to NVIDIA’s accelerated computing infrastructure, software, and expertise, promoting the growth of the next generation of companies in South Korea.

Through these comprehensive efforts, South Korea and NVIDIA are not only expanding AI infrastructure but also fostering an ecosystem that supports innovation and economic growth, positioning South Korea as a leader in the global AI landscape.

Japan-Based Bitcoin Treasury Company Metaplanet Completes $1.4 Billion IPO! Will It Buy Bitcoin? Here Are the Details

Japan-based Bitcoin treasury company Metaplanet announced today that it has successfully completed its public offering process. Metaplanet Grows Bitcoin Treasury with $1.4 Billion IPO The company’s CEO, Simon Gerovich, stated in a post on the X platform that a large number of institutional investors participated in the process. Among the investors, mutual funds, sovereign wealth funds, and hedge funds were notable. According to Gerovich, approximately 100 institutional investors participated in roadshows held prior to the IPO. Ultimately, over 70 investors participated in Metaplanet’s capital raising. Previously disclosed information indicated that the company had raised approximately $1.4 billion through the IPO. This funding will accelerate Metaplanet’s growth plans and, in particular, allow the company to increase its balance sheet Bitcoin holdings. Gerovich emphasized that this step will propel Metaplanet to its next stage of development and strengthen the company’s global Bitcoin strategy. Metaplanet has recently become one of the leading companies in Japan in promoting digital asset adoption. The company has previously stated that it views Bitcoin as a long-term store of value. This large-scale IPO is considered a significant step in not only strengthening Metaplanet’s capital but also consolidating Japan’s role in the global crypto finance market. *This is not investment advice.
